Healthcare content writing roles offer a lucrative path for writers focused on combining scientific insights, data analysis, and patient education. Given the increasing need for authoritative healthcare content, many health systems and medical marketing agencies trust skilled medical content creators to develop content that educates and engages audiences. Health writing spans a wide range of areas, ranging from clinical trial documentation, patient education materials, medical blog posts, and approval documents. Authors with a deep understanding of medical terminology and a talent for breaking down complex concepts for non-experts are essential.
A key reason independent health writing opportunities are so appealing is the flexibility they offer. Several healthcare workers, such as nurses, pharmacists, and even specialists, have transitioned to freelance medical writing to leverage their knowledge while enjoying a more balanced work-life balance. Independent healthcare writing also attracts those outside the healthcare professions who have a passion in health topics and an ability to translate medical jargon into accessible, engaging language. Whether you are developing patient education brochures or submission packets, the precision and readability of your content are vital in this field.
To excel in this evolving market, remote health writers must possess exceptional research abilities, impeccable grammar, and a keen eye for detail. Many clients prefer writers who can support their statements with credible studies, ensuring the writing they release is credible and meets medical protocols. Remote writers should also be adaptable to different writing styles and understand the specific needs of medical audiences, including patients, clinicians, and oversight bodies.
Freelance medical writing encompasses diverse opportunities, from ghostwriting for physician blogs to authoring continuing medical education (CME) modules for practitioners. Given the rising importance of digital health and telemedicine, medical companies require content experts who can produce compelling content for multiple platforms, including websites, newsletters, social media, and academic journals. This requirement has opened abundant opportunities for independent writers to forge long-term relationships with clients who value consistent writing support.
